April 2026: Focused on stabilizing macOS builds in the tuist/tuist repository. Implemented embedding of built products in Copy Files phases via a new CopyFileElement.buildProduct, and fixed macOS-specific output path collisions by ensuring the Swift macro copy phase runs for macOS targets. These changes improve build reliability and efficiency, reduce CI flakiness, and accelerate developer feedback loops for macOS projects.
